Company details

We empower our clients to learn from our experience so that together we can push the boundaries of the campaigns and maintain long-term sustainable results.

Based in Switzerland, with staff across North America and Europe that speak many languages we can help grow your sales globally. We helped our clients run successful ad campaigns in many countries including USA, Canada, Mexico, Brazil, Ecuador, UK, Germany, France, Netherlands, Belgium, Austria, Denmark, Finland, Sweden, Norway, Romania, Colombia, Singapore, Hong Kong, Israel, Ireland, Korea, Argentina, Indonesia, South Africa, Italy, and others.